2/ Data shows that economic crises & austerity measures lead to increased suicide rates.

The suicide rate in the most deprived areas is already twice that of the least deprived areas. These cuts would further widen the inequalities.

🧡 1/ I’m concerned that, if implemented in NI, the welfare cuts announced today would be utterly devastating for those with mental illness, & plunge many into suicidal distress.

Whilst suicide is complex, there is strong evidence of the link between financial pressure & suicide

Tobacco and Vapes Bill will save lives – Nesbitt Health Minister Mike Nesbitt has welcomed the NI Assembly’s support for Northern Ireland’s inclusion in the UK Tobacco and Vapes Bill.

A historic day in the NI Assembly as we passed the Tobacco and Vapes Bill which includes NI in the U.K. Tobacco and Vapes Bill. This will make it illegal for tobacco products to be sold to anyone born on or after 1st Jan 2009. This will save countless lives. www.health-ni.gov.uk/news/tobacco...
